comparemela.com

Top Locations Tagged with Tsc Richmond Indiana

Tsc Richmond Indiana in United States - 47374/Supermarket near richmond/Supermarket near Richmond

1). Tractor Supply Company , Chester, In

2). Tractor Supply Co, National Rd E

vimarsana © 2020. All Rights Reserved.